How to export SharePoint users and groups permissions to excel?

Here is the shortcut to export SharePoint users and groups permission to Excel. Open your SharePoint site in Internet Explorer. Navigate to either Site permissions or any User group. Right click on the users list page, choose “Export to Excel” item. You may need to reformat it a bit! Here is it would look like:

How to view permission list for a group in SharePoint?

The URL when viewing a group is of the format http://yourServer/_layouts/people.aspx?MembershipGroupId=25. 25 is the group ID. Browse to this page http://yourServer/_layouts/viewgrouppermissions.aspx?ID=25, and change the ID to the ID of the group you want to view.
